SanDisk Announces 2GB Flash Drives

Posted Apr 5th, 2005 by Chief Gizmateer

SanDisk announced two new USB 2.0 flash hard drives, the Cruzer Profile, and the 2 gigabyte Cruzer Titanium. The Cruzer Profile is a 512 megabyte or 1 GB flash drive with fingerprint security to protect your data, and the 2 GB Cruzer Titanium is a flash drive with a titanium body for strength. The Cruzer Profile is intended for people who wish to keep their data secure and control who can access it. The product is the size of pack of gum (60 mm long, 24 mm wide, and 14 mm in height) and comes in 512 MB or 1 GB capacities. SanDisk’s 2 GB Cruzer Titanium is a USB 2.0 flash drive that the company called “virtually indestructible.” The company said that the device is being manufactured from a titanium alloy that is 2.5 times stronger than normal titanium.
